BEUTHEN a lordship and circle of Upper Silesia created a free barony by the emperor Leopold, in 1697 It has for boundaries the lordship of Plesse on the south Oppeln on the west and north and Poland on the east The inhabitants speak the Polish language and are mostly Catholics This barony was conferred on count Leo of Donnersmark by the king of Prussia in 1745
